Fixed '0 of X users' in FilteredUserList and cleaned up pluralization of 'member'

This commit is contained in:
hmhealey
2016-03-02 12:08:55 -05:00
committed by Harrison Healey
parent a92b51935e
commit 366bc4fd57
4 changed files with 15 additions and 16 deletions

View File

@@ -55,20 +55,17 @@ class FilteredUserList extends React.Component {
});
}
let memberString = formatMessage(holders.member);
if (users.length !== 1) {
memberString += 's';
}
let count;
if (users.length === this.props.users.length) {
count = (
<FormattedMessage
id='filtered_user_list.count'
defaultMessage='{count} {member}'
defaultMessage='{count} {count, plural,
one {member}
other {members}
}'
values={{
count: users.length,
member: memberString
count: users.length
}}
/>
);
@@ -76,10 +73,12 @@ class FilteredUserList extends React.Component {
count = (
<FormattedMessage
id='filtered_user_list.countTotal'
defaultMessage='{count} {member} of {total} Total'
defaultMessage='{count} {count, plural,
one {member}
other {members}
} of {total} Total'
values={{
count: users.length,
member: memberString,
total: this.props.users.length
}}
/>

View File

@@ -666,8 +666,8 @@
"file_upload.filesAbove": "Files above {max}MB could not be uploaded: {filenames}",
"file_upload.limited": "Uploads limited to {count} files maximum. Please use additional posts for more files.",
"file_upload.pasted": "Image Pasted at ",
"filtered_user_list.count": "{count} {member}",
"filtered_user_list.countTotal": "{count} {member} of {total} Total",
"filtered_user_list.count": "{count, number} {count, plural, one {member} other {members}}",
"filtered_user_list.countTotal": "{count, number} {count, plural, one {member} other {members}} of {total} Total",
"filtered_user_list.member": "Member",
"filtered_user_list.search": "Search members",
"find_team.email": "Email",

View File

@@ -666,8 +666,8 @@
"file_upload.filesAbove": "No se pueden subir archivos de más de {max}MB: {filenames}",
"file_upload.limited": "Se pueden subir un máximo de {count} archivos. Por favor envía otros mensajes para adjuntar más archivos.",
"file_upload.pasted": "Imagen Pegada el ",
"filtered_user_list.count": "{count} {member}",
"filtered_user_list.countTotal": "{count} {member} de {total} Total",
"filtered_user_list.count": "{count, number} {count, plural, one {Miembro} other {Miembros}}",
"filtered_user_list.countTotal": "{count, number} {count, plural, one {Miembro} other {Miembros}} de {total} Total",
"filtered_user_list.member": "Miembro",
"filtered_user_list.search": "Buscar miembros",
"find_team.email": "Correo electrónico",

View File

@@ -666,8 +666,8 @@
"file_upload.filesAbove": "Arquivos acima {max}MB não podem ser enviados: {filenames}",
"file_upload.limited": "Limite máximo de uploads de {count} arquivos. Por favor use um post adicional para mais arquivos.",
"file_upload.pasted": "Imagem Colada em ",
"filtered_user_list.count": "{count} {member}",
"filtered_user_list.countTotal": "{count} {member} de {total} Total",
"filtered_user_list.count": "{count, number} {count, plural, one {Mensagem} other {Mensagems}}",
"filtered_user_list.countTotal": "{count, number} {count, plural, one {Mensagem} other {Mensagems}} de {total} Total",
"filtered_user_list.message": "Mensagem",
"filtered_user_list.search": "Procurar membros",
"find_team.email": "E-mail",